St. Pete police officer extricated after driver crashes into parked patrol car

Posted at 10:59 PM, Aug 27, 2018
and last updated 2018-08-28 02:27:54-04

ST. PETERSBURG, Fla. — A St. Petersburg officer was extricated from her patrol car after another driver hit it on Monday night.

Police says that at 9:17 p.m., a patrol officer was assisting the St. Petersburg Fire Department and Duke Energy while they repaired some downed power lines. The police officer was inside her parked patrol car with her lights activated at Melrose Ave S. and 31st Street to divert traffic.

The driver of a Lexus sedan, later identified as 66-year-old Harry Fields, crashed into the parked patrol car. The police officer was extricated and suffered non-life threatening injuries. She is hospitalized in stable condition. 

The name of the officer has not been released.

The investigation continues and charges are pending.
